Court of Criminal Appeals of Texas

Stephen Ray Nethery, Appellant v. the State of Texas, Appellee

May 22, 19851985 Tex. Crim. App. LEXIS 1688

Summary

The Court affirmed the conviction and death sentence, overruling all of appellant's fifty‑five alleged errors, including challenges to juror exclusions, denial of a change of venue, the sufficiency of the indictment, evidentiary rulings, and sentencing‑phase testimony. The Court held that the trial court acted within its discretion and that the evidence supported the capital murder conviction and the death penalty.
